A heavy, brush-like handwritten italic with rounded terminals and softly irregular contours. Strokes are thick and consistent, with occasional swelling and slight wobble that preserves a drawn-by-hand texture rather than geometric precision. Letterforms lean forward with a springy baseline rhythm, open counters, and simplified shapes that keep silhouettes bold and readable at display sizes. Spacing is somewhat lively and uneven in a natural way, reinforcing the handmade feel across both caps and lowercase.
Best suited to short, attention-grabbing text such as posters, playful headlines, product packaging, stickers, and social graphics where bold, friendly personality is a priority. It can work for brief subheads or callouts, but the heavy texture and animated rhythm are strongest when used in larger sizes rather than dense body copy.
The overall tone is upbeat and approachable, evoking marker lettering and casual signwriting. Its forward slant and bouncy shapes create a sense of motion and friendliness, making text feel conversational and fun rather than formal or technical.
Designed to capture the look of confident hand-drawn brush lettering in a sturdy, high-impact style. The intention appears to be delivering instant warmth and informality while staying bold enough for titles and display applications.
Capitals read as chunky, poster-like shapes with soft corners, while lowercase maintains the same weight and momentum without joining strokes, preserving a print-handwritten character. Numerals are similarly rounded and sturdy, designed to match the broad, brushy texture and remain legible in short strings.
